MINUTES — Management Meeting: Divestiture of the Torvane Instruments Unit

Attendees: all heads of department. The committee reviewed, in detail, the proposed sale of Torvane Instruments to Calloway Group. Valuation assumptions, staff transfer terms, and facility leases in Merridow were examined carefully. Legal confirmed no outstanding encumbrances. HR will prepare a retention plan before signing. Each department head must submit a transition risk assessment within ten days. The strategic rationale is summarized confidentially below.

board note of kageg-bahof: The renewal with Holwynax Holdings closes at $2 million a year, 5 percent below the last contract. Project Ulaath slips by two quarters because of the supplier delay.

Handover — telemetry compression (Skylark SDK)

Plugin payloads now gzip automatically above 4KB; below that, raw JSON. Don't double-compress — the collector rejects nested encodings with a 422. Dictionary-based compression (zstd) is behind the `compactWire` flag, off by default. Benchmarks from the Tornquist cluster show ~60% reduction on typical span batches. Remaining work: streaming mode for long-lived plugins. Wire format spec and flag rollout schedule are at the page below.

runbook for baguf-bawip: https://jira.qorvelsys.internal/pages/pages/pages/browse/1853

FAQ: Why does the ChipGate reader buffer reads locally?

The Fenrow Marathon's ChipGate reader stores timing-chip reads on local flash whenever the uplink drops, then replays them in order on reconnect. Reviewers should check that replay batches preserve monotonic sequence numbers. If the reader's maintenance console locks after three failed logins, restore access using the passphrase below.

unlock words, yawig-kagef: gordor-holvan-ulaael-pramir-ulaiel-tamdor